The 220W efficiency is an important figure, but it's crucial to understand that this is a theoretical maximum power output. In practice, energy production will depend on numerous factors, such as the panel's tilt angle relative to the sun, the presence of shadows, ambient temperature, and light quality. GearLab highlights the importance of these variables for achieving optimal performance.
